The mass customization revolution has reached the sex toy industry, with young adults embracing made-to-order pleasure products. Companies like BMS Factory offer 3D-printed vibrators tailored to individual anatomy and preferences. "Why settle for one-size-fits-none?" asks a customization enthusiast.
Options range from adjustable vibration patterns to bespoke shapes based on body scans. Some services even incorporate personal symbolism - one customer had a vibrator modeled after her partner's fingerprint. The price premium (often 2-3 times standard products) doesn't deter devotees seeking perfect personalization.
This trend mirrors broader consumer expectations for tailored experiences in everything from sneakers to skincare. As 3D printing technology advances, some predict at-home customization kits could become the next frontier, though regulatory hurdles remain.
For a generation accustomed to personalizing every aspect of their lives, from phone cases to Spotify playlists, customized pleasure products represent the logical next step in the "me economy."
